The course 'Providing Constructive Feedback' offers a comprehensive method to deliver effective feedback. The video-led training program encompasses every aspect, from delivering palatable feedback, focusing on the right issues, to involving everyone in solution-finding process.
Helping someone to improve their performance or learn from a mistake is a sensitive task. Of course, you could be brutally honest and tell them, “You’re not doing this right, try improving!” Surprisingly, this approach rarely proves effective.Â
Fortunately, with the ‘Providing Constructive Feedback’ course, you get an approach that works. This video-led training program covers every aspect – from delivering feedback that people will genuinely take on board, identifying the right issues to focus on, to involving everyone in the solution-finding process for the issues at hand.Â
You will also see numerous examples of ineffective feedback.  It’s always good to know what behaviors to avoid, and it can be quite entertaining – especially when it’s not directed at you.  Learning how to improve doesn’t mean you can’t have a good laugh, leaving your coworkers wondering what’s up.
